Cost of living in Asbury Park research summary. The cost of living index is set to 100 for the average place in the United States. A cost of living index above 100 means Asbury Park is expensive. An index value below 100 means the city is a relatively cheap place to live.
On a city-by-city basis in New Jersey, home prices and rent have the biggest impact on the cost of living. Here are the key takeaways based on Saturday Night Science:
The cost of living index in Asbury Park is 142, with 100 being the average.
The cost of living index in Asbury Park is 1.4x higher than the national average.
Asbury Park ranks as the #181 cheapest in New Jersey out of 260.
Asbury Park ranks as the #5,468 cheapest out of 6,489 in the US.
The median home value in Asbury Park is $662,295.
The median income in Asbury Park is $71,080.
According to the most recent data on the cost of living, Asbury Park has an overall cost of living index of 142, which is 1.4x higher than the national index of 100.
Compared to New Jersey, Asbury Park has a cost of living index that's 1.2x higher than New Jersey's index of 122.
The standard of living in Asbury Park ranks as #181 most affordable out of the 260 places we measured in New Jersey. By definition, that implies Asbury Park ranks as the #79 most expensive place in the Garden State.

Six factors go into calculating the cost of living index in Asbury Park. Here is how it fairs on each of the criteria:
The Services index in Asbury Park is 127.
The Groceries index in Asbury Park is 111.
The Health index in Asbury Park is 122.
The Housing index in Asbury Park is 192.
The Transportation index in Asbury Park is 117.
The Utilities index in Asbury Park is 103.
| Living Expense | Asbury Park | New Jersey | National Average | |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Overall | 142 | 122 | 100 | |
| Services | 127 | 108 | 100 | |
| Groceries | 111 | 104 | 100 | |
| Health | 122 | 99 | 100 | |
| Housing | 192 | 159 | 100 | |
| Transportation | 117 | 101 | 100 | |
| Utilities | 103 | 107 | 100 | |
Housing swings affordability the most between places in New Jersey, so we broke down housing costs into more detail. Home and income data comes from the most recent US Census ACS 2019-2023. The key points are:
The Median Home Value in Asbury Park is $662,295.
The Median Rent in Asbury Park is $1,679.
The Median Income in Asbury Park is $71,080.
The Home Value To Income in Asbury Park is 9.3x.
The Rent To Monthly Income in Asbury Park is 0.28x.
| Statistic | Asbury Park | New Jersey | United States |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Home Value | $662,295 | $564,432 | $303,400 |
| Median Rent | $1,679 | $1,653 | $1,348 |
| Median Income | $71,080 | $101,050 | $78,538 |
| Home Value To Income | 9.3x | 5.6x | 3.9x |
| Rent To Monthly Income | 0.28x | 0.2x | 0.21x |
